As a Software Engineer, you will design avionics, power electronics, and battery systems with an emphasis on AHRS and INS products using the latest advances in sensor technologies. You’ll create unique intellectual property to address the growing demand for software-defined behavior. You can expect a variety of opportunities ranging from
products for cockpit displays, instruments and navigational references based on local and remote sensor inputs. Additional products include data conversion and storage, lithium battery management, AC and DC power conversion, and in-seat power solutions. WHAT YOU CAN EXPECT FROM ONE DAY TO THE NEXT…
• Design and implement embedded C software for bare-metal microcontroller-based systems with an option for VHDL firmware for FPGA-based systems
• Architect and implement ARHS and INS products utilizing MEMS, FOG or other commercially available technologies
• Design tools to support manufacturing, calibration and verification of safety-critical products
• Build and troubleshoot hardware, including basic soldering, operation of test equipment, and daily work in both office and test lab environments
• Prototype and execute test programs to verify compliance with applicable performance, regulatory, and quality requirements
